What Exactly is a Tax Debt Compromise? ๐ค
A tax debt compromise is a formal agreement between a taxpayer and SARS. Under this agreement, SARS agrees to accept a lower amount than the total tax debt owed as a final settlement. If the taxpayer meets all the conditions of the agreement, SARS will permanently write off the remaining portion of the debt.
The primary goal of this programme is to secure the highest possible return for the state while offering a taxpayer a second chance. It's a more practical solution for SARS than forcing a business into liquidation or an individual into sequestration, where they might recover even less.
Who Qualifies for a Tax Compromise?
Not everyone is eligible for a compromise. SARS has specific criteria to ensure the system isn't abused. Generally, you may qualify if:
1. You are unable to pay the full debt. You must be able to prove to SARS, through a detailed financial disclosure, that you lack the assets and income to settle the full amount, both now and in the foreseeable future.
The compromise is beneficial to the state.
2. SARS must be convinced that accepting a lower amount will be a better financial outcome for the fiscus than taking legal action to recover the full debt.
3.You are tax compliant. You must have all your tax returns filed and be up-to-date with your current tax obligations. You cannot ask for a compromise on old debt while creating new debt.
3. You have not been convicted of a tax offence or failed to comply with a previous compromise agreement in the last three years.
